IT/T COMMITTEE DISCUSSIONS
4/19/18
7:30 a.m. Annex Building
An IT/T Committee meeting was scheduled for this date (4/19/18), but due to two council
members being absent, this could not be an actual committee meeting, only discussions with
department heads. Therefore, please treat the discussions as informational only.
Discussions called to order at 7:35 a.m.
Attendees: Justin Chandler, Mark Starr, Scott Snyder, Dawna Wood, David Scheffler, Paul
Martin and Holly Miller‐Downour
Committee Members Absent: Tom Stoughton, and Melody Bobbitt,
Meeting Minutes for 2/15/18 were reviewed, but could not be approved.
Old Business
Any Updates to the following:
o Narrowbanding Project – 99.9% complete – there are a couple odd radios that
need replaced – inoperability w/County – Emergency Management Agency
(EMA) trying to assist. The question was asked at the last meeting regarding
how much money was spent on this project ‐ $820K was transferred but spent
$840 – did go over, but it came out of the budget.
o Upgrading police and fire radios ‐ completed
o Fiber optics upgrades/installation(s) begun several years ago – 2 repairs still
need to be completed.
o Development of a Sort Program/Auditor’s Office Evaluation of new Software –
Auditor’s office – 6 mos. Out on project and they have decided what they want.
A demo was conducted with the Mayor. An RFQ and RFP will be conducted. In
reference to the Sort Program, there has been some development and it has
produced some results. Will be reviewed at the next meeting.
o Explore merging the Clerk of Courts and City IT departments – no movement
o 911 Upgrade – Waiting on another major quote – no issues with what they have
received just questioning whether or not it will be 911 only or with CAD. 911
Consolidation, conceptually not a bad idea, but if consolidated there would be
no backup plan.
o VDI – Relationship with Dell and they are currently looking at VDI
o Changes in organization – They consult IT and it is always a goal – not a battle to
fight right now.
Projects for 2018
o Software – Police Department
o Software – Auditor’s Office
5‐Year Plan Outline
o All agreed that what was received wasn’t really a 5‐year plan and Holly will send
some examples to Dawna.
New Business
Audit w/IT and all other depts. – tell us how accurate the charges are and whether or
not what we are charging is correct – Outside Independent Firm
New Project – Office 365 – Exchange Accounts – SPAM filter and office package – put in
next year’s budget – help with password changes and controls.
Installing 2 new generators @ the 2 radio sites – monitored propane – no natural gas
available – discount on propane and monitored as a public service – 2 weeks
3 new police interceptors – 1st of next week – LDOT provides lettering
Install and upgrade a new server – moved Fire Dept. and SQL Database – backup DNS
Special Presentation – Scott GIS Coordinator provided a demonstration on Cartegraph and
moving us to online mapping, getting things pushed out to IPads – DB system w/mapping. ESRI
is the company. Cartegraph – Asset Management – took all work against assets.
Gas/LDOT/Code Enforcement – largest users of Cartegraph. Scott supports other depts. that
don’t have a data specialist.
Adjournment at 8:44 a.m.
